WebInclusion refers to placement of students with disabilities in the general education classroom with peers without disabilities. Inclusion generally connotes more comprehensive programming than the somewhat dated term mainstreaming. The courts, however, tend to use the terms synonymously. WebMar 5, 2024 · Resource room – A resource room provides an opportunity for intensive instruction outside of the classroom. Students go to the resource room for a part of the day to work on particular subjects with a special education teacher. Only a few students are in the resource room at a time, which allows for more individualized and/or small group ...
